How to fill out the MA DoR 355Q online

This guide provides detailed instructions on how to complete the MA DoR 355Q application for manufacturing classification online. Whether you are familiar with digital forms or this is your first time, this comprehensive guide will assist you through the process.

  2. Begin by entering the name of your corporation in the designated field.
  3. Provide your federal identification number. This number is essential for tax identification purposes.
  4. Fill in the street address, city or town, state, and zip code where your corporation is located.
  5. Input the phone number of your corporation for contact purposes.
  6. Enter the date of incorporation and the state in which your corporation was incorporated.
  7. List all business locations in Massachusetts by providing the city or town and the activities performed at each location, such as sales or manufacturing.
  8. Indicate whether your corporation is presently engaged in manufacturing in Massachusetts by selecting 'Yes' or 'No'. If selecting 'No', provide the anticipated start date for manufacturing activities.
  9. Describe the principal business activity of the corporation in Massachusetts, attaching additional statements as necessary.
  10. Summarize all activities conducted outside of Massachusetts, again attaching statements if needed.
  11. Provide a detailed description of the manufacturing process or activities performed by employees and others associated with your business.
  12. State total payments to Massachusetts employees and detail the number of employees engaged directly in manufacturing, ensuring to compute the percentages correctly.
  13. Detail the machinery used directly in manufacturing, including number, type, condition, and original cost. Mention if leased, stating the rental cost.
  14. Indicate the costs associated with all other machinery and tangible property located in Massachusetts, if applicable.
  15. State the total gross receipts resulting from activities in Massachusetts for the previous year and the expected receipts for the current year, again including the manufacturing breakdown.
  16. Include any other relevant facts that may justify your classification as a manufacturing corporation.
  17. Complete the declaration by signing and dating the form, along with providing the name and phone number of the contact person.
